Kenya gets IMF approval but report warns security needs tightening

Nairobi; Kenya: The International Monetary Fund (IMF) has given a thumbs-up to Kenya's progress in implementing economic reforms but warned that the country remains highly vulnerable to deteriorating security conditions, weather-related shocks and difficulties in implementing devolution.

The report indicates that although the Jubilee Government started the process of devolution at a fast pace, introducing a reporting framework that allows for monitoring progress and challenges, however, coupled with a dispute over implementation of the devolved system of Government has sparked calls for a referendum by governors who are demanding more resources be channelled to the grass-roots.
